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Update UI code of cli-template-monorepo-ethers and cli-template-monorepo-subgraph #836

Open
vplasencia opened this issue Jul 24, 2024 · 4 comments · May be fixed by #841
Open

Update UI code of cli-template-monorepo-ethers and cli-template-monorepo-subgraph #836

vplasencia opened this issue Jul 24, 2024 · 4 comments · May be fixed by #841
Assignees
Labels
good first issue Good for newcomers refactoring ♻️ A code change that neither fixes a bug nor adds a feature

Comments

@vplasencia
Copy link
Member

Description

It would be nice to update the cli-template-monorepo-ethers and cli-template-monorepo-subgraph UI code with the same code as the boilerplate following the React good practices.

Boilerplate UI code: https://github.com/semaphore-protocol/boilerplate/tree/main/apps/web-app

@vplasencia vplasencia added good first issue Good for newcomers refactoring ♻️ A code change that neither fixes a bug nor adds a feature labels Jul 24, 2024
@yagopajarino
Copy link

Hi @vplasencia, I may be able to contribute with this refactoring. Could you assign it to me?

@vplasencia
Copy link
Member Author

Hey @yagopajarino ! Thank you. I just assigned you the issue. Let us know if you have any questions.

yagopajarino added a commit to yagopajarino/semaphore that referenced this issue Jul 28, 2024
yagopajarino added a commit to yagopajarino/semaphore that referenced this issue Jul 28, 2024
yagopajarino added a commit to yagopajarino/semaphore that referenced this issue Jul 28, 2024
@yagopajarino yagopajarino linked a pull request Jul 28, 2024 that will close this issue
7 tasks
@yagopajarino
Copy link

Hi @vplasencia, I summited the PR but looks like it's failing everywhere. However I tested it locally and worked fine.

I realized the new UI uses chakra components, therefore some new packages need to be installed but github actions don't allow me to do so.

image

Let me know what you think and what changes should I do

@vplasencia
Copy link
Member Author

Hey @yagopajarino thank you very much for the PR 🙏. I will take a look as soon as possible.

yagopajarino added a commit to yagopajarino/semaphore that referenced this issue Jul 30, 2024
yagopajarino added a commit to yagopajarino/semaphore that referenced this issue Aug 12, 2024
yagopajarino added a commit to yagopajarino/semaphore that referenced this issue Aug 12, 2024
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
good first issue Good for newcomers refactoring ♻️ A code change that neither fixes a bug nor adds a feature
Projects
Status: 👀 In review
Development

Successfully merging a pull request may close this issue.

2 participants